Centering Black Narrative: Black Muslim Nobles Among the Early Pious Muslims moulid A simple yet captivating storyBlackness is a term which has been understood differently based upon time and geography. The authors of this book explore how the term was understood by Arabs during the era surrounding the first three generations of Muslims and how such context can better inform understanding who from among them would today be considered Black Muslims in the West.
